Anna Christie

from Drama of the Week · host BBC Radio 4

Anna Christie has spent fifteen years waiting for a father who never came. When she finally arrives on the New York waterfront to find him, she brings with her a past she has told nobody, and a fury at the world that has shaped her whole life. What she doesn't expect is the sea itself, and what it might do to her.Eugene O'Neill's Pulitzer Prize-winning drama is one of the towering works of American theatre: a searingly honest portrait of people trying to outrun their histories, until a shipwrecked Irish stoker arrives out of the fog and gives Anna a reason to stop running.Adapted for radio by Lucy Catherine.Story of America is a major collection of dramatisations of milestone American titles marking 250 years since the Declaration of Independence and the foundation of the United States.Anna . . . . .
